Abstract
The present invention discloses a kind of safety cap, including cap shell, hat lining, cap hoop and head rest band, the outer wall of the cap shell is detachably provided with the first buffer structure, the second buffer gear is provided between cap shell and hat lining, first buffer gear includes consistent with cap shell shape and there are the auxiliaring shells of a fixed spacing with cap shell, the buffer spring being uniformly arranged between the elastic layer and elastic layer and auxiliaring shell being detachably sheathed on cap shell outer wall, second buffer gear includes the first airbag restraint layer being arranged between cap shell and hat lining, the safety cap significantly improves the safety of operation and the comfort of wearing.

Background technique
Safety cap is the protective articles for preventing alluvium injury head.It is made of cap shell, hat lining, lower cheekstrap and back ferrule.When
When impact of the operating personnel head by falling object, impact force is first decomposed into skull in moment using safety helmet shell, hat lining
It is then broken using the flexible deformation of each position buffer structure of safety cap, plastic deformation and the structure of permission on the entire area of bone
It is bad to absorb most of impact force, it is remarkably decreased the impact force for being finally applied to person head, to play protection operation people
The effect on the head of member.
In the structure of safety cap, hits the impact of object and puncture kinetic energy and mainly born by cap shell.When beating for high-altitude tenesmus
Hit object it is heavier when, the buffer capacity of the safety cap of existing structure is limited, however it remains biggish security risk.
